true
false
0

Address Details

0xC6A42934Af45391c82a988a73170d72bE2889fFE

Balance
16,562.060274700000011065 ECS
Tokens
Fetching tokens...
Transactions
26 Transactions
Transfers
20 Transfers
Gas Used
2,741,765
Last Balance Update
28580256

Token Transfers